Description


Creates a spline surface equivalent to IGES entity type 114 by specifying a collection of parametric (u,v) polynomial spline patches.  The following table describes the mathematical form of the Spline surface.

Application Notes


Surface deformation

The Spline Surface is a sagable surface.
